Presenting without Powerpoint

Posted in Public Speaking, 2007, TV Presenting, UK at 9:02 pm by Jeremy Jacobs

I think that statement is a contradiction in terms!

Trying to present an idea or to persuade an audience to do something needs you, the presenter or speaker to engage with your audience. Relying on technology like Powerpoint to help you out (unless you are a lecturer with a didactic style) will not work. I agree with the sentiments outlined at Neville Hobson’s blog.

As a presenter, you are the presentation!
